Job Description

VF Corporation is looking for a Health and Safety and Security Advisor​(fixed term 1 year contract) to join our team based in Belgium.

Let's talk about the role
As the local Health and Safety and Security Advisor of a Distribution Center, you are directly responsible for keeping local management and EMEA Asset Protection Management informed on all levels of risk of any issues or new legislation. You are focused and detailed in executing all safety and security programs to keep the VF employees safe. You are an advocate and influencer capable of leading cross-functional teams to maintain safety and security standards. As a collaborator, you enjoy working with different location /DC managers and departments to generate a positive risk culture throughout VF.

How You Will Make a Difference:

  • Responsible for oversight of the risk assessments and safety/security programs in the distribution center.
  • Implement an asset protection (AP) culture maintaining each specific location culture.
  • Collaborate with EMEA H&S, DC OPS; Human Resources, maintenance, to be the employee safety representative and external partners
  • Responsible for the development of safety tools, programs, reports and training ensuring a consistent message to minimize risk and control losses.
  • Make sure all incidents (H&S and Security) and accidents are reported and investigated.
  • Minimize risk through tracking and managing all incidents and employee injuries.
  • Support Management / DC leaders in managing safety incidents and emergency procedures.
  • Protect VF’s reputation by ensuring stakeholder awareness for liability exposure and spearheading strategic responses to critical issues.
  • Assures compliance with VF global health & safety and security standards and country regulations.
  • Provide leadership team with guidance on security and confirm compliance with industry, local, state, and federal guidelines, and regulations.
  • Develop, implement, and maintain physical security guidelines and operating procedures for the DC.
  • Manage the DC security team (3rd party), meet regularly with their security management to maximize security standards.
  • Develop, implement, and maintain loss prevention guidelines and operating procedures for Distribution Center.
  • Timely completion of regular security audits and inspections for the DC and follow up of action items.
  • Regularly meet with the EMEA AP team to ensure compliance standards are met, company goals are achieved, and shared best practices are being implemented.
  • Work closely with Law Enforcement officials on the investigation of suspected criminal activity.


Skills for Success:

  • Related Professional Experience: 2-5 years
  • Good knowledge of English
  • Ability to provide professional support to the local management
  • Ability to lead and train cross departmental/brand teams and achieve results
  • Working knowledge of Safety/Security Regulations (Local and VF standard) in a DC environment
  • Ability to communicate clearly (verbally and written).
  • Follows through/executes all tasks, assignments and job duties in a timely manner.
  • Strong interpersonal and influencing skills.
  • Strong presentation preparation and presenting skills.
  • Self-motivated and driven.
  • Proficiency using Excel, Word, and PowerPoint.


Educational/ Position Requirements:

  • A bachelor’s degree or certification of H&S and Fire, a minimum of 2 years’ experience in an operational work environment.
  • Experience in Security
  • Experience in project management and/or in leadership role preferred.

Special Physical and/or Mental Requirements:

  • Some travel by air and overnight, as required.
  • Bend, lift, open and move product and related office items.
